Find the tangent of A if the cosine of A is -√3 / 2

1) Find the sine of this angle using the basic trigonometric identity: sin (A) = √ (1 – cos2 (A)) = √ (1 – (-√3 / 2) 2) = 1/2.
2) The tangent is equal to the ratio of sine to cosine. Substitute the sine and cosine values and get: tg (A) = sin (A) / cos (A) = (1/2) / (- √3 / 2) = -√3.
ANSWER: -√3.
